    1.3.0 submitted 2/7/2021 - available when you see it in the ACP, should be a day or two from now
    NEW! Core - Lazy-load option for userphotos NEW! Forums - Index - Option to hide the circle-dot unread marker on sub-forums (sub-forum titles remain bolded when unread) NEW! Forums - Topics - append topic author's user group after author's name. Plain or formatted. ADD! A few new language strings to replace hard-coded text in settings. The lazy load is the newer browser-based lazy flag. That's all. IPS will eventually be removing all their own javascript lazy load stuff in a later version of Invision Community in favor of the new browser standards - this just jumps ahead of the line for userphotos - mainly due to all the noise from that topic a week or two ago. This is like a two second hook to make so figured I'd throw it in. This will, naturally, get yanked when IPS eventually flips stuff over...
    The rest should be self-explanatory

    If you mean the Searchlight functionality coming from clicking those autocomplete links, then no, as the terms for Searchlight marking are pulled from the search results form, and this plugin is giving you results you click directly to right there. So Searchlight would have nothing to mark out. If you ignored those auto-complete suggestions and went on through to the usual search results, then the marking would work.

    SUBRTX reacted to ABGenc in Change TABLE row format from COMPACT to DYNAMIC - Tutorial   
    Thats is what I have got during upgrade yesterday and thanks to a previous post (below) which saved the day. We can overcome upgrade error just like you have shown in your video but there may be more tables ( I had mode than 150 in my case) which causes a warning each time you run Support Tool.
    Since I did not want to put a script on the server which was suggested on the other post, I had to do them in batches as you have shown in video which of course took a while.
    By the way you can get a list of the tables if you have SSH access to MYSQL
    >MYSQL
    >USE <DBNAME> ;
    > SHOW TABLE STATUS  WHERE Row_format="Compact";

    Members = people who are logged in.
    Guest = members who aren't logged in OR don't have an account.
    Visitors = members+guests.

    Also, when you say "guest and member chart" are you talking about what is found in 'ACP->Statistics->Users->Online Users'? Because if you are, do note that this is NOT an actual traffic chart and if you sum up the numbers you WILL NOT get the number of visitors your site has, as explained here.
